Alligator found at Stewart Middle School in Tampa
TAMPA - The principal at Stewart Middle School got an unwelcome surprise early Monday morning when he found an alligator on school grounds.
According to Tampa Police spokesperson Andrea Davis, the 7 foot long alligator was found in front of the cafeteria and then contained in one of the schools hallways.
Members of the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ission and trappers caught the alligator and removed it from the premises.
The alligator was later euthanzied.
Hillsborough County school district spokeswoman Linda Cobbe said the alligator was found before students arrived and they were kept away. No one was hurt.
